Cultural Meaning Of Delicate Praying Hands with a Single Rose Tattoo Design
The tattoo's cultural significance is deeply rooted in its use of the Praying Handstattoo idea, a universal symbol of spirituality, hope, and penitence. Representing a personal gesture of prayer, the hands signify a connection to the divine and a moment of internal reflection. The fine line tattoo style enhances this symbolism, offering an elegant and understated representation that echoes the quiet yet profound nature of the act itself. The rose, a timeless emblem of beauty and passion, intertwines with the religious aspects to suggest purity and grace. Together, these elements form a visual narrative that speaks to the harmonization of human faith and nature's beauty, inviting contemplation on themes of love, peace, and devotion.
Design Inspiration Of Delicate Praying Hands with a Single Rose Tattoo Design
This tattoo design draws inspiration from classical religious iconography, where the gesture of praying hands is a familiar motif in various artistic traditions. The addition of the rose introduces an element of romantic and natural symbolism, reflecting the beauty and complexity of human spirituality. The use of fine line tattoo style is influenced by modern minimalist trends, seeking to distill these significant symbols into their purest forms, thus creating a contemporary piece that resonates with timeless themes.
